Different Types of Key Cuts For Cars
You want the top quality whether you're having your keys cut or replace one that has been lost. You want to ensure that the key fits perfectly into the lock and is able to start your car key blade cutting without a hitch.
Traditional keys are crafted with cuts on their edges, which coincide with pin patterns that are found in the locks to allow them to be opened. The most advanced keys have been laser-cut and offer many security advantages.
Sidewinder Keys
Sidewinder keys are also known as internal cut keys or internal cut. They are an advanced key technology that is more advanced and provides an increased level of security. They have a distinctive appearance and are distinguished by the central groove cut into the middle blade. This unique feature has earned them the title "sidewinder." In contrast to traditional key blades they have flat sides and no notches. This makes them impossible to use using a standard tool. They also stop them from being inserted into the lock only in one direction.
Apart from their unique appearance They are also thinner than standard keys for cars. They are slimmer to fit inside Smart Key Fobs and make them much easier to use as emergency keys. Furthermore, their smaller size allows them to easily be put into wallets with card slots. In addition to their distinctive look they require the most sophisticated key cutting machine and are generally more expensive than standard car keys.
The major drawback of this technology is that it is only compatible with certain types of car key cutting service locks. If you have an older car, it will probably not be able accommodate the key, so you will need to replace the lock cylinder. Additionally, the key must be programmed to begin your vehicle with the help of a specialist.
The locksmith must have the original cut, also known as the "keycode," in order to make an entirely new sidewinder. This can be done by deciphering the keycode with their keen eye, or it can be obtained from an external source. The locksmith then needs to install a specialized sidewinder key cutting machine that will conform to the specifications of your vehicle's lock.

Transponder Keys
Most modern cars use transponder keys, which are also known as chip keys. They are named after the electronic microchip in the head of the key. When your transponder keys are inserted into the ignition it sends out an electrical signal that activates the microchip within the car to allow the car to begin. The chip in your transponder key is powered by radio signals it receives and does not have its own battery.
The technology behind the transponder key was developed to help combat car thefts. It's not 100% secure as it has been found that there are ways to "hot wire" cars that have this system installed. However it has made the task of stealing cars much harder for novice and old-school car keys cut by code thieves.
There are many different kinds of transponder keys to choose from. There are many different kinds of transponder keys. They may be blade-style that are inserted into the cylinder of your ignition key. Or they can be incorporated into your key fob.
